Bethesda Executive Criticizes Online Leaks Before Starfield’s September Launch

Bethesda is brimming with excitement over their highly anticipated project, Starfield. This forthcoming outer-space-themed role-playing game has captivated the hearts of fans worldwide with its immersive and detailed forty-five-minute trailer, known as Starfield Direct. As the game’s September 6th launch date draws near, ardent fans and Starfield enthusiasts are fervently leaking exclusive information to fuel the flames of anticipation.

In the midst of this frenzy, Bethesda has been confronted with a wave of online leaks that have irked one of their executives. Expressing his dissatisfaction, the Bethesda executive voiced his frustration, stating, “I really don’t like that.” These leaks have undoubtedly stirred up a storm and have the potential to impact the game’s release.
